Have any of you tried these? Costco was demo'ing them yesterday and I like them so well, I bought a box. The only thing burger about them is the shape. To me they tasted like roasted veggies, particularly peppers. They are really healthy in that they are made with oat bran, are cholesterol free, GMO free and contain no trans fatty acids. Each burger has 110 calories, 35 cals from fat, 4g fat, 12 g carb (5 of which are fiber) and 7g of protein.

The ingredient list is carrots, onions, string beans, soy beans, zucchini, peas, textured soy flour, spinach broccoli, oat bran, canola oil, corn, red pepper, arrowroot, cornstarch, corn meal, salt, parsley and black pepper.

Ya, I did like them even after eating the whole thing, plain. They're not like any veggie burger I have ever had. These have really small chunks of all the veggies listed that you can actually see. Also, they haven't made much of an attempt to make it look like a burger colorwise. Overall it's kind of a green color. i still think the overall taste is of roasted veggies.
